Game Mechanics and Objectives
The primary goal of BeeWorkshop is to create a thriving and sustainable hive. Players must work together to collect resources, defend the hive from threats, and optimize productivity. The game is set over several "seasons," each presenting unique challenges and opportunities. Success depends on how well players can adapt to changing conditions and make strategic decisions to ensure the survival and growth of their hive.
Roles and Responsibilities
In BeeWorkshop, players can choose from various roles, such as Worker Bees, Drone Bees, and the Queen Bee, each with distinct abilities and responsibilities. Worker Bees are tasked with collecting nectar and pollen, constructing new hive areas, and maintaining the hive's health. Drones focus on defense and supporting the Queen Bee, while the Queen is responsible for laying eggs and leading the hive.

Rules of the Game
The rules of BeeWorkshop are designed to be intuitive, yet they offer depth for those who wish to delve deeper into strategy. Each player starts with a set number of action points per season, which they can use to perform various tasks relevant to their bee's role. These tasks include foraging for resources, expanding the hive, and defending against threats such as predators or environmental hazards.
Resource Management
Effective resource management is essential in BeeWorkshop. Players must balance immediate needs against long-term hive development. Resources like nectar and pollen must be gathered and processed efficiently to produce honey, which serves as the primary currency for developing the hive and unlocking new capabilities.
Seasonal Challenges
Each season presents unique challenges that require players to adapt their strategies. For example, spring might offer abundant resources, while winter could pose significant scarcity, necessitating careful planning and resource conservation. Players must also remain vigilant against natural disasters and human-induced threats, such as pesticides and habitat loss, reflecting real-world issues affecting bee populations.
